2014 is the 10th Birthday of Ty Gobaith, the sister children's hospice to Hope House, both of which my family have been involved in supporting since my brother Matthew died in 1989.  So it seems a good reason to get my arse into gear and do some fundraising for them!

Without the services of the 2 hospices many families in North and Mid Wales and Shropshire and Cheshire would have much harder lives.

Looking after children with terminal illnesses and life limiting conditions is exhausting and the care, support and fun provided by the hospices for these special children and their families is invaluable. This care doesn't end if the child is lost - it continues and is a lifeline to many families.

Challenge Number 1 was chilly!  The Llandudno Boxing Day dip was fun but freezing. 

Now for the BIG ONE!  Walk around Anglesey in 10 days.  That's over 125 miles once I have got to and from campsites that are not handily placed where I need them!  This is going to really push me.  I'll have family and friends popping along to keep me company but a lot of the time it will just be me and a large rucksack.

Training is going well and I've been building up to the multiple days of walking but your support and any funds I raise will be what keeps me going when it is chucking it down with rain (as it invariably will in Wales in September!)

We’re here to ensure that children with life-threatening conditions enjoy the best quality of life, together with their families. We provide specialist care and bereavement support, when and where they need it, and work to ensure that no one faces the death of a child alone.
